]> granicus.if.org Git - graphviz/commitdiff
remove useless MSBuild link dependency on ortho for neato_layout plugin
authorMagnus Jacobsson <Magnus.Jacobsson@berotec.se>
Mon, 12 Jul 2021 05:50:59 +0000 (07:50 +0200)
committerMagnus Jacobsson <Magnus.Jacobsson@berotec.se>
Wed, 14 Jul 2021 09:18:42 +0000 (11:18 +0200)
The neato_layout plugin only depends indirectly on ortho through
neatogen which it already has a link dependency on.

This change is made to avoid confusion when upcoming commits in this
series change ortho to be part of the gvc shared library and adjusts
the neatogen library accordingly.

Towards https://gitlab.com/graphviz/graphviz/-/issues/2096.

plugin/neato_layout/gvplugin_neato_layout.vcxproj

index 5d849d9730a207a85401e6b03855fa47e2f42a4f..957bdbc13b074ad6562389014b6f5e37644c8c6c 100644 (file)
@@ -67,7 +67,7 @@
       <SubSystem>Windows</SubSystem>
       <DataExecutionPrevention />
       <TargetMachine>MachineX86</TargetMachine>
-      <AdditionalDependencies>cgraph.lib;gvc.lib;pathplan.lib;neatogen.lib;circogen.lib;twopigen.lib;fdpgen.lib;sparse.lib;cdt.lib;glib-2.0.lib;vpsc.lib;patchwork.lib;gvortho.lib;%(AdditionalDependencies)</AdditionalDependencies>
+      <AdditionalDependencies>cgraph.lib;gvc.lib;pathplan.lib;neatogen.lib;circogen.lib;twopigen.lib;fdpgen.lib;sparse.lib;cdt.lib;glib-2.0.lib;vpsc.lib;patchwork.lib;%(AdditionalDependencies)</AdditionalDependencies>
     </Link>
   </ItemDefinitionGroup>
   <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">
@@ -86,7 +86,7 @@
       <EnableCOMDATFolding>true</EnableCOMDATFolding>
       <DataExecutionPrevention />
       <TargetMachine>MachineX86</TargetMachine>
-      <AdditionalDependencies>cgraph.lib;gvc.lib;pathplan.lib;neatogen.lib;circogen.lib;twopigen.lib;fdpgen.lib;sparse.lib;cdt.lib;glib-2.0.lib;vpsc.lib;patchwork.lib;gvortho.lib;%(AdditionalDependencies)</AdditionalDependencies>
+      <AdditionalDependencies>cgraph.lib;gvc.lib;pathplan.lib;neatogen.lib;circogen.lib;twopigen.lib;fdpgen.lib;sparse.lib;cdt.lib;glib-2.0.lib;vpsc.lib;patchwork.lib;%(AdditionalDependencies)</AdditionalDependencies>
     </Link>
   </ItemDefinitionGroup>
   <ItemGroup>